
分析符合正态分布规律的数据结构可以通过以下几个步骤实现:绘制直方图、QQ图、计算描述性统计量、进行正态性检验。绘制直方图是最简单直观的方法,通过观察数据的频次分布是否呈现钟形曲线,可以初步判断数据是否符合正态分布。QQ图(Quantile-Quantile图)则是更精确的方法,通过将样本分位数与标准正态分布的分位数进行比较,如果点大致在一条直线上,则数据接近正态分布。描述性统计量如均值、标准差、偏度和峰度也是重要的指标,偏度和峰度接近0时,数据更可能符合正态分布。正态性检验如Shapiro-Wilk检验、Kolmogorov-Smirnov检验可以进一步验证数据是否符合正态分布,这些检验通过统计检验的方法给出一个P值,当P值大于某个显著性水平(如0.05)时,可以认为数据符合正态分布。
一、绘制直方图
绘制直方图是分析数据是否符合正态分布最简单且直观的方法之一。通过直方图,我们可以观察数据的频次分布是否呈现钟形曲线。钟形曲线是正态分布的典型特征,即数据在均值附近最集中,随着距离均值越远,数据的频次逐渐减少。直方图可以通过多种软件工具绘制,如Excel、Matlab、Python中的Matplotlib等。在绘制直方图时,选择适当的组距和组数非常重要,过多或过少的组数都会影响直方图的形态,从而影响对数据分布形态的判断。通过直方图可以初步判断数据是否符合正态分布,但由于其直观性,在数据量较大或数据噪声较多的情况下,可能不够准确。
二、绘制QQ图
QQ图(Quantile-Quantile图)是更精确的判断数据是否符合正态分布的方法。QQ图通过将样本分位数与标准正态分布的分位数进行比较,如果点大致在一条直线上,则数据接近正态分布。绘制QQ图的方法通常是先将数据进行排序,然后计算出每个数据点的分位数,再与标准正态分布的分位数进行比较。在Python中,可以使用SciPy库中的qqplot函数来绘制QQ图。如果QQ图中的点偏离直线较多,则说明数据不符合正态分布。QQ图不仅可以用于判断正态分布,还可以用于其他分布的判断,如指数分布、对数正态分布等。
三、计算描述性统计量
描述性统计量如均值、标准差、偏度和峰度是分析数据分布的重要指标。均值和标准差可以描述数据的集中趋势和离散程度,而偏度和峰度则可以描述数据分布的形态。对于正态分布数据,偏度和峰度应接近0,偏度为0表示数据分布对称,峰度为0表示数据分布的尖峰程度与标准正态分布相似。通过计算这些描述性统计量,可以进一步判断数据是否符合正态分布。在Python中,可以使用Pandas库的describe函数来计算均值和标准差,使用SciPy库的skew和kurtosis函数来计算偏度和峰度。
四、进行正态性检验
正态性检验是通过统计检验的方法来验证数据是否符合正态分布。常见的正态性检验方法包括Shapiro-Wilk检验、Kolmogorov-Smirnov检验等。Shapiro-Wilk检验是最常用的正态性检验方法之一,通过计算W统计量来判断数据是否符合正态分布,当W值接近1时,数据更可能符合正态分布。Kolmogorov-Smirnov检验则通过计算样本分布与标准正态分布之间的差异来判断数据是否符合正态分布。在Python中,可以使用SciPy库的shapiro和kstest函数来进行正态性检验。这些检验通过统计检验的方法给出一个P值,当P值大于某个显著性水平(如0.05)时,可以认为数据符合正态分布。
在数据分析过程中,FineBI可以帮助我们更高效地完成上述分析步骤。FineBI是一款由帆软旗下推出的商业智能工具,支持数据可视化分析和报告制作。通过FineBI,我们可以轻松绘制直方图和QQ图,计算描述性统计量,并进行正态性检验,从而快速判断数据是否符合正态分布。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
什么是正态分布,如何识别符合正态分布的数据结构?
正态分布,也称为高斯分布,是一种在统计学中广泛应用的概率分布。其图形呈现出一个对称的钟形曲线,大部分数据集中在均值附近,随着距离均值的增加,数据的频率逐渐降低。要识别数据是否符合正态分布,可以采用多种方法:
-
可视化方法:通过直方图、箱线图和Q-Q图等可视化工具,可以直观地判断数据的分布情况。直方图应呈现对称形状,Q-Q图则应呈现一条接近于45度的直线。
-
统计检验:常用的正态性检验有Shapiro-Wilk检验、Kolmogorov-Smirnov检验和Anderson-Darling检验。这些方法可以帮助评估数据是否显著偏离正态分布。
-
描述性统计:计算数据的偏度和峰度。对于正态分布,偏度应接近于0,峰度应接近于3。偏度的正负值可以指示数据的对称性,而峰度则反映数据的尖峭程度。
如何对符合正态分布的数据进行分析和应用?
在统计分析中,符合正态分布的数据为许多统计方法的应用提供了基础。以下是一些分析和应用的主要步骤:
-
参数估计:当数据符合正态分布时,可以使用均值和标准差来描述数据的中心位置和分散程度。均值和标准差可以通过样本数据计算得出,并用于进一步的分析。
-
假设检验:利用正态分布的性质,可以进行各种假设检验,如t检验和ANOVA。这些检验方法通常要求数据遵循正态分布,确保结果的有效性和可靠性。
-
置信区间:在正态分布的假设下,可以计算参数的置信区间。这对于进行推断统计非常重要,能够帮助研究者了解样本数据对总体的代表性。
-
回归分析:在进行线性回归时,假设残差是正态分布的。通过分析符合正态分布的数据,可以建立更为准确的预测模型。
如何处理不符合正态分布的数据?
有时,实际收集到的数据并不符合正态分布。在这种情况下,可以采取以下措施:
-
数据变换:对数据进行变换,如对数变换、平方根变换或Box-Cox变换,以使数据更接近正态分布。
-
非参数检验:当数据不符合正态分布时,可以使用非参数检验方法,如Wilcoxon秩和检验和Kruskal-Wallis检验。这些方法不依赖于数据的分布假设,适用于更广泛的情况。
-
使用模拟方法:在某些情况下,可以通过引导法或其他模拟方法来评估不符合正态分布的数据。这些方法基于数据本身,能够更灵活地处理复杂的分布情况。
-
增加样本量:在一些情况下,增大样本量可能有助于数据更接近正态分布。根据中心极限定理,大样本的均值往往趋向于正态分布,这为后续分析提供了更好的基础。
通过对符合正态分布的数据进行系统的分析和处理,能够为研究者在各个领域的决策提供科学依据,从而提高数据分析的准确性和有效性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



